1. Joie Roomie Glide
The Roomie Glide is an innovative bedside cot made by English brand Joie that was designed to help you co-sleep safely without sharing your bed. It has a smooth, single-hand glide that gently eases baby into dreamland without you having to get off your side of the bed. It also has an easy-to-use glide lock that secures it when your baby is fast asleep. There are safety straps to keep it firmly attached to your bed, and retractable wheels that let you move it whenever you want to.
The softly padded sides, double-mesh windows and the curved cocoon shape enhance the comfort of your child sleeper. It is also easy to assemble and disassemble, making it ideal for travel and packing. The cot is simple to wipe clean and comes with a machine washable mattress cover. Additional sheets of cotton are available in packs of two.
Roanna loved the cotbed, and described it as "a quality purchase". She also appreciated the feeling that the gliding motion was soft, which helped her fall to sleep. She also thought the design was elegant and said it would look great in most bedroom decors. However, she did point out that although it's a great choice for babies, once they're six months old, you'll need to buy them an extra large cot.
She also liked the fact that the sliding side panel could be lifted by one hand, which meant she could easily respond to wake-up calls from her bed to feed or soothe her children. Another benefit was that the Roomie Glide has 11 height adjustments, so it can be adapted to almost any size bed, and it comes with clips and straps that can be used to secure it securely.
2. BassiNest
The HALO Bassinest Swivel Sleeper comes with plenty of features with a side pouch ideal for diapers, nipple cream and all the other essentials you'll need during the newborn stage. It comes with a sturdy mattress and base that can be cleaned easily after blowouts, spit-ups and other mishaps with infants. Plus, it comes with a machine-washable sheet to keep it clean.
The best thing about this cot for bed is that it rotates 360 degrees, which means you can get closer to your baby to ensure safe sleep. Its patented side walls lower and automatically return to allow you to take care of your baby without getting up from your bed. This is crucial for moms who are recovering from C-sections.
The swivel feature makes it easy to pick up your baby to cuddle and feeds while you're sleeping. It has a nightlight, three soothing sounds, two levels of vibration and a nursing timer to ensure you are on the right path with your breastfeeding or bottle-feeding routine.
The premium version includes wood accents for a more sophisticated appearance and a high-quality yarn-dyed fabric. It also features an adjustable floor lamp that helps you see at night without disturbing your baby or partner, and a storage caddy for essentials. Both versions of the HALO Bassinest come with a sturdy and adjustable base that can fit alongside beds that are up to 34" tall. The side wall can also be locked to increase security. It's designed to be used until your child shows signs of rolling over or reaches 20 lbs and is JPMA certified and independently tested to meet U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ission and Health Canada safety standards.

3. Maxi-Cosi lora
The sleek bedside bassinet features an elegant design, with a range of contemporary colours, and wood effect features. It's a success for sleep. The mesh is breathable, allowing plenty of air to circulate and provides you with a great view of your baby. The mattress is sturdy enough for even naps during the day as well as nighttime sleep. It also has a reflux-incline function to reduce reflux and congestion in the event of a need. When you're ready to move your baby to their own room, it converts to a stylish standalone crib with an incredibly comfortable mattress. It can be folded flat and put away in a convenient travel bag so that you can take it on a weekend trip or when your baby is at Grandma's.
This co-sleeper has been shortlisted for the 2021 Mother&Baby Awards, which are for the most beautiful Cot or Crib or Moses Basket. It provides maximum comfort for babies during the first few months of. It has a breathable mattress that is extra thick and adjustable to five different heights and a rocking feature for napping with a fuss. Plus, it's made with EcoCare Maxi-Cosi's brand new premium, future-proof fabric which is soft and comfy on baby's skin.
Its slim frame makes it smaller than other cots that are bedside and is easy to raise to the correct bed level using just two levers (although some mums were unable to get the bar that connects the legs difficult to move up and down). It can also be moved side to side to place it closer to the bed to feed your baby at night or to help soothe your baby to sleep. And like other bedsides, it comes with a large storage basket that can be used underneath to store all your baby essentials.
4. Shnuggle Air
Shnuggle is an organization that creates products that make parenting easier for parents and safer for babies. The company was founded with their first hypoallergenic wicker-less moses basket in 2009 and has since won more than 50 consumer and industry awards.
The crib's dual-view mesh sides maximize the airflow and allow you to keep an eye on baby. Its mattress, which is tested to meet the most stringent British safety standards and is 50 percent more air-tight. The crib can also be transformed into a cot (kit sold separately) and is an ideal sleeping option for infants and toddlers. small bedside cot padded sides prevent babies' arms or legs from getting caught in the cot bars, and its fabrics are washable and removable.
This bedside crib is easy to move around due to its swivel wheel. It attaches securely to a bed frame or divan. This is the only product on this list with a side that can be removed and drop down. It can be opened for evening comforting or for feeding.
In contrast to the bassinets featured in this guide, this bassinet features soft padded sides, rather than cot bars, which keep little legs and arms from getting caught or entangled. It's also a great option for breastfeeding mothers or women who have had a c-section since it's easy to get baby in and out for nursing and relaxing.
It also has more features than most of the other cribs on this list, including a gentle incline for reflux and colic and a hammock for storage underneath and seven height adjustments. Our parents who have tested it have reported that the safety latch at the top bar may be noisy when it is being reattached. This may wake your baby. The mattress and the fabric are both movable and hand washed and the crib is easy to assemble.
